Big news for US sports bettors: ESPN BET will officially rebrand as theScore Bet on December 1, 2025, following a mutually agreed upon decision between PENN Entertainment and ESPN to end their licensing agreement.
That means a new era for US online sports betting built on the award-winning theScore Bet platform, already a proven success in Canada.

Types of Bets Available at theScore Bet
While the official list of markets for US bettors hasn’t yet been confirmed, here’s what’s already available on theScore Bet in Canada — and what you can reasonably expect to see when it launches stateside:
- Moneyline: The simplest form of betting — pick who you think will win a given game or event. For example, if the Kansas City Chiefs are listed at -150 against the Philadelphia Eagles (+130), the Chiefs are favored to win.
- Spreads: Bet on a team to win (or not lose) by a certain number of points. If the Chiefs are -3.5, they need to win by 4 or more for your bet to cash.
- Totals (Over/Under): Wager on whether the total combined score of a game will be over or under a specific number.
- Parlays & Same-Game Parlays: Combine multiple bets into one wager for a bigger payout. TheScore Bet’s SGP builder in Canada is quick and visually clean — expect the same in the US version.
- Props: Get specific with team or player outcomes, like total passing yards or goals scored.
- Live (In-Play) Betting: Bet on changing odds as the game unfolds in real-time. TheScore Bet’s live betting interface in Canada is fast and responsive, with real-time stats and animations.
- Futures: Place bets on long-term outcomes like who will win the Super Bowl, Stanley Cup, or MVP awards.

TheScore Bet will officially return to the US market as part of ESPN BET’s rebrand on December 1, 2025.
TheScore Bet is expected to be available in all current ESPN BET legal states, which include: AZ, CO, IA, IL, IN, KS, KY, LA, MD, MA, MI, NJ, NC, OH, PA, TN, VA, WV, and DC.
Yes. Existing ESPN BET users should expect a seamless transition to theScore Bet when the rebrand occurs. Your account balance, bet history, and personal information should all carry over automatically once the update goes live.
